summ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orIlya Mashchenko <ilya@netdata.cloud>2022-09-24 12:50:39 +0300
committerGitHub <noreply@github.com>2022-09-24 12:50:39 +0300
commit5e0d532e19ad338dd499bad49773d51d797b45d6 (patch)
tree6397d4eba1773dfad1f41194c08bf9544b6610b0
parentbbd980845c33e50822650fb9f7d812ec3d430aa0 (diff)
feat(health): add new Redis alarms (#13715)
-rw-r--r--health/health.d/redis.conf29
1 files changed, 29 insertions, 0 deletions
diff --git a/health/health.d/redis.conf b/health/health.d/redis.conf
index cad5230c51..34d00b5df8 100644
--- a/health/health.d/redis.conf
+++ b/health/health.d/redis.conf
@@ -1,3 +1,18 @@
+# you can disable an alarm notification by setting the 'to' line to: silent
+
+ template: redis_connections_rejected
+ families: *
+ on: redis.connections
+ class: Errors
+ type: KV Storage
+component: Redis
+ lookup: sum -1m unaligned of rejected
+ every: 10s
+ units: connections
+ warn: $this > 0
+ info: connections rejected because of maxclients limit in the last minute
+ delay: down 5m multiplier 1.5 max 1h
+ to: dba
template: redis_bgsave_broken
families: *
@@ -26,3 +41,17 @@ component: Redis
info: duration of the on-going RDB save operation
delay: down 5m multiplier 1.5 max 1h
to: dba
+
+ template: redis_master_link_down
+ families: *
+ on: redis.master_link_down_since_time
+ class: Errors
+ type: KV Storage
+component: Redis
+ every: 10s
+ calc: $time
+ units: seconds
+ crit: $this != nan AND $this > 0
+ info: time elapsed since the link between master and slave is down
+ delay: down 5m multiplier 1.5 max 1h
+ to: dba